Phase IB clinical trial to assess the safety, tolerability, and preliminary efficacy of AloCELYVIR (Mesenchymal allogenic cells + ICOVIR-5) in children, adolescent and young adults with newly diagnosed diffuse intrinsic pointine glioma (DIPG) in combination with radiotherapy or medulloblastoma in relapse/progression in monotherapy.
This study is testing a new treatment called AloCelyvir for children and young adults with two types of brain cancer: newly diagnosed DIPG or medulloblastoma that has returned. It's looking to see if the treatment is safe and what effects it might have.

Phase I/II stUdy of ALoCelyvir in patientS with mEtastaticUveal Melanoma (PULSE-UM)
This study is looking at a new treatment called AloCelyvir for people with a type of eye cancer that has spread. It's an early stage study to see if the treatment works and how safe it is. Doctors will measure if tumours shrink and how long people live.

Feasibility clinical trial of the combination of AloCelyvir with chemotherapy and radiotherapy for the treatment of children and adolescents with relapsed or refractory extracranial solid tumors.
This study looks at a new treatment called AloCelyvir, combined with usual chemotherapy and radiotherapy, for young people (aged 18 and older) with cancer outside the brain that has come back or not responded to previous treatments. It aims to find the safest dose.
